Subset of Q&A

Q: what is calculation: CEIL?

A: ceiling

Q: will python interface be supported?

A: For Python, we will support REST Web Services for embedding scenarios

Q: Any plans for Fiori look and feel? This to align with S/4HANA embdeed analytics

A: Yes, we are using some of the SAPUI5 components, and following Fiori look and feel as much as possible; S/4 HANA embedding is a very important scenario to us

Q: Can u restrict what is available via Mobile App and what is not….by user?

A: You can restrict what stories a user will see, this will be reflected in both the mobile app and when viewing via the browser. We don’t have a specific mobile app restriction

Q: will you align the R- Server versions? SBOC requires a newer R-Serve release and HANA developers use an older R-Serve version

A: or now we will require a newer version, goal is to unify the R versions but must check into this timeline

Q: Reverse proxy in mobile app?

A: yes, this is supported

Q: Is Python supported for predictive?

A: not at the moment
